Using a Railcard for 1/3 off
Explore a range of Railcards that typically offer 1/3 off most train tickets, including the 16-25, 26-30, Family & Friends, Two Together, Network and Senior Railcards, as well as the 16-17 Saver, which offers 50% off. Travel during Off-Peak train times
We'd strongly suggest avoiding rush hour crowds by travelling on Off-Peak services, often leading to a cheaper and more peaceful journey. Exact timings vary between providers, but in general, skip travelling between 06:30 AM–09:30 AM and 4:00 PM–7:00 PM on weekdays. Off-Peak rates are available all day on weekends and bank holidays.

Split Tickets discount
It may sound odd, but splitting your journey into smaller segments by purchasing separate, cheaper tickets can often lead to significant savings, all while you remain in the same seat for the entire trip. Which train ticket types are available for this route?

Advance train tickets
Available up to 12 weeks before the journey, these are generally the most cost-effective option for cost-conscious travellers

First Class tickets
Enjoy an upgraded journey with First Class tickets, which usually provide spacious seating, a calmer environment, and added perks like free drinks or snacks with selected train operators

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ak tickets
Offers lower fares and greater flexibility when you avoid travelling during busy weekday periods

Return train tickets
Covers a round trip, including both the outward and return journeys between the same two stations
